Fully paid 4 years Ph.D.
positions within the Electromagnetics Group

At present several fully paid 4 years Ph.D. positions are available

within the Electromagnetics Group of the Dept. of Information

Technology. Apart from a Master’s degree in Electrical or Physical

Engineering and good knowledge of English, basic (graduate)

knowledge in Electromagnetics and high-frequency electronics is

sufficient.



The Ph.D. candidate will be provided with all guidance

and hardware and software tools necessary to perform state-of-the

art research in one of the following fields:

• High-frequency behavior of Integrated Circuits (ICs) with a

special focus on ICs for the automotive industry. This research will

be conducted in cooperation with Flemish industry partners, such as

Melexis and ON Semiconductor, and also within a consortium of well-

known European electronics manufacturers, such as Philips, NXP,

Bosch, Infineon, …

• Flexible and implantable antennas (in cooperation with Recticel

and Flanders’ Drive)

• Design and modeling of advanced submicron interconnect

technologies of ICs (in cooperation with Agilent Technologies)

• Advanced time-domain (FDTD) and finite element (FE) techniques for

the simulation of antennas for usage within the ADS-framework of

Agilent Technologies

• Detection of concealed objects with millimeter waves (within a

Strategic Basic Research project of the IWT) and early detection of

breast tumors

• Fast Maxwell solvers for very large and complex structures in

cooperation with foreign research groups in the USA, Finland, Italy,

Turkey, and Israel.
